🔧 What’s Included in a Samtop CGI Mockup?
Element | Purpose | File Output |
---|---|---|
🧴 Product Model | Accurate 3D of bottle or box, Pantone/label correct | .OBJ , .GLB , .PNG , .MP4 |
🧱 Display Structure | Glorifier, tester tray, logo panels in true size | .FBX , .STP , .PSD renders |
🎨 Finishes & Materials | Matte, gloss, metallic, velvet, acrylic mapped finishes | PBR shaders, UV texture maps |
💡 Lighting Simulation | In-store retail lighting (3000K, spotlight, ambient) | Layered .PSD , .MOV walkthrough |
🏬 Retail Context | Store shelf, gondola, pop-up, or window environment | Full CGI render or cutout for deck |

🔍 Real Case Study: CGI Glorifier for Global Lipstick Launch
🟨 Client: Luxury beauty brand launching a 4-shade lipstick series
🟨 Challenge:
- Show tester tray layout with Pantone-matched lipstick tubes
- Preview the base in matte vs. metallic finish
- Align 3 regional teams before printing or sampling
🟩 Samtop Solution:
- 3D modeled each lipstick with Pantone and embossing detail
- Created 2 base variants (champagne metal and matte black)
- Rendered under 3000K LED shelf lighting
- Delivered .PSD files with color masks, plus export-ready .JPGs and .KEY deck
✅ Result:
- 2-day global approval cycle (vs. 2-week sample shipping)
- Used in Sephora VM presentation
- Reused as teaser asset in digital campaigns

📐 Our 5-Step CGI Twin Process
1️⃣ You send dielines, 2D artwork, CAD, or photo references
2️⃣ We build your product + glorifier in textured 3D
3️⃣ We render in a simulated retail setting with accurate light/shadow
4️⃣ You receive: image set, Keynote-ready visuals, or video loop
5️⃣ You approve and share — before cutting a single prototype
